When I've run 17's they're as follows:
Fronts:
17x8 (4.75" b/s) 245/45's
Rears:
17x9.5 (5.5" b/s) 285/40's

These fit my particular car no problem.I even shimmed the rears outward to give me extra inside clearance and I still had room to the fenderlip.
I would suggest running a 275/40 rear tire however,that will afford you extra room.Keep in mind my car's kinda a freak...

I currently run an 18" setup as follows:
Fronts:
18x8 (4.875" b/s) 245/40's
Rears:
18x10 (5.625" b/s) 275/40's

You'll need to be spot-on to run this combination w/o issues and your suspension has to be quite firm.
